Nuveen's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Nuveen held 3,469 positions worth $362B, up 9.8% from $330B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Nuveen's Q2 2025 filing shows 192 new, 989 increased, 1,979 reduced and 199 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Janus Henderson AAA CLO ETF: 4,258,000 shares worth $216M. The largest sale was Nuveen Growth Opportunities ETF, an estimated $2.48B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 33% of assets, up from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
